Transaction 860fe62a106da2472f1064488b03db407471fdc02111d60e169114461454d490
1 Input
3 Outputs
- 860fe62a106da2472f1064488b03db407471fdc02111d60e169114461454d490:0
- 860fe62a106da2472f1064488b03db407471fdc02111d60e169114461454d490:1
- 860fe62a106da2472f1064488b03db407471fdc02111d60e169114461454d490:2
value 9748440
address 12XCxgWEiX2YZFPZcrgWMVfaCXd9r5kvvg
value 9609600
address 18E2NHFSYxg55sgJPkKiKzvEzqor6qpNZD
value 472532273
address 1kLthnZkq38LRp8bK86VkU1AUiq7kzLoe